In Switzerland, a hydro power plant of the Kraftwerke Linth-Limmern AG in the canton of Glarus faced the task of carrying out a comprehensive revision of Pelton turbines that had been in operation since the 1960s. Although the units had undergone a major revision more than 20 years ago, it was time for another comprehensive modernization to ensure long-term operational reliability.
The plant operators entrusted Global Hydro with this task - and the revitalization of Machine Group 2 of the hydropower plant became a clear demonstration of what sets us apart: technical precision, flexibility, and a commitment to partnership built on trust. With these values, the team of experts successfully prepared the 60-year-old powerhouse for decades to come.
| Location: | Canton of Glarus, Switzerland |
| Turbines: | 2x horizontal Pelton Turbines, 23 MW |
| Net head: | 480.9 m |
| Flow per unit: | 5.5 m³/s |
| Timeline: | Machine Group 2: 2024-2025, Machine Group 1: 2025-2026 |
| Initial issue: | Total failure of nozzle #2: Unit operated in single-nozzle mode only. |
The hydropower facility houses two horizontal-axis, double-nozzle Pelton turbines, each with a capacity of 23 MW. Over time, both units began to show significant signs of wear - especially Machine Group 2 (MG2), which had been last overhauled 25 years ago and experienced substantial wear due to sand abrasion.
In recent years, one of MG2’s nozzles began failing to close reliably. By 2023, even opening the nozzle became problematic, forcing the turbine to run in single-nozzle mode. As the root cause of the malfunction remained unclear, a full-scale revitalization of the inlet, nozzle systems, and servomechanisms was initiated to restore full functionality and ensure long-term reliability.

Following the completion of the revitalization work, Machine Group 2 entered trial operation and concluded testing in June 2025 - flawlessly and without any operational issues. Machine Group 1 is scheduled for an overhaul during the winter of 2025 and 2026.

A malfunctioning nozzle could no longer open or close reliably, forcing the turbine to run in single-nozzle mode. With the root cause unclear and efficiency declining, the operator faced growing performance losses and operational risk. A full revitalization was essential to restore functionality, secure output, and extend the unit’s lifetime.
Global Hydro implemented a tailored revitalization package that included the complete overhaul of inlet and nozzle systems, as well as the refurbishment of servomotors, sealings, and protective coatings. Thanks to in-house expertise, precise diagnostics, and transparent communication, the project was carried out with technical accuracy and reliability – even in the face of unforeseen challenges.
The revitalization restored full functionality of both nozzles, allowing the turbine to run again in dual-nozzle mode. This significantly improved energy output, operational efficiency, and stability. With refurbished components and modern sealing and coating systems, the plant is now set for long-term reliable performance and reduced maintenance requirements.
